Bandar Tasik Selatan transport terminal to open by year end

The new Integrated Transport Terminal (ITT) at Bandar Tasik Selatan has been completed ahead of schedule and will officially open by the end of the year.

Land Public Transport Commission (SPAD) chairman Tan Sri Syed Hamid Albar visited the RM570mil terminal on September 29.

The terminal’s operation management system will use advanced electronics that will feature the use of single ticketing system, which prevents touts and illegal ticket sellers.

Syed Hamid said the new ITT was built in response to the public complaints on the connectivity between public transport systems.

The terminal will link up the light rail transit (LRT), express rail link (ERL) and KTM Komuter lines.

The terminal is an initiative under the Government Transfor-mation Programme (GTP)’s urban public transport (UPT) National Key Results Area (NKRA) to improve the public transport system in the Klang Valley.

The Bandar Tasik Selatan ITT has the capacity to handle 40,000 passengers and 1,000 buses per day.

Up to 110 buses can be accommodated per hour.

Departure and arrival bays are located on the second floor of the six-storey complex.

The lobby for passengers will be on the concourse level while taxi stands will be on the third floor.

A dedicated commercial area will be on the fourth floor while parking bays are located on the fifth and sixth floors.
